About I/O Structure
Output data is received by the adapter in the order of the installed I/O
modules. The Output data for slot 0 is received first, followed by the
Output data for slot 1, and so on up to slot 7.
The first word of input data sent by the adapter is the Adapter Status
Word. This is followed by the input data from each slot, in the order
of the installed I/O modules. The Input data from slot 0 is first after
the status word, following by Input data from slot 2, and so on up to
slot 7.
